#3794e5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3794e5 is composed of 21.6% red, 58%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76% cyan, 35.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 207.9 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 55.7%. #3794e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#6effff with #0029cb.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#3794e5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010508 is the darkest color, while #f6f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3794e5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8e8e is the less saturated color, while #2695f6 is the most saturated one.
